NameVirtualHost www.domaine.com
<VirtualHost www.domaine.com>
ServerName www.domaine.com
DocumentRoot /home/httpd/solid
IndexOptions IconHeight IconWidth FoldersFirst
User httpd
</VirtualHost>

- voici ma configuration actuelle
- de ce que j'ai compris chez toi c'est pareille
- mais il existe un probleme quand ton ip et www.domain.com change car tu
fait l'update chez zoneedit.com : donc pour apache lancien www.domain.com
pointe sur un autre ip car ton ip est diferent de l'ancien qui veut dire que
il ne fait plus la relation entre le nouveau ip et ton vhost.


> Le Fri, 20 Dec 2002 18:57:42 +0100
> "yahoo" <[EMAIL PROTECTED]> a tapot� sur son clavier :
>
> > bonjour a tous,
> > je vien vers vous avec un probleme que je ne sait pas resoudre :
> >
> > - j'ai achete un nom de domaine
> > - je me suis enregistre chez zoneedit.com avec se nom de domaine
> > - avec ddclient je met a jour mon ip a chaque fois qu'il change (car je
suis equipe de l'adsl et toutes les 24 heures le fourniseur chenge mon ip)
> > - j'ai cree un virtual host www.domaine.com qui pointe vers un directeur
par ex /home/httpd
> > - le souci que j'ai actuellement est que je doit redemarer apache toutes
les heures dans cron affin que apache fait la corelation avec le nom cite
plus haut.
> >
> > Ce que je veut faire est donc un script comme ddclient qui verifie la
fonctionalite du virtual host www.domaine.com et dans le cas contraire de
redemarer apache.
> >
> > J'ai cherche sur le net sans trouver quelque chose.
> >
> > Une autre solution existe (en teorie) de faire un script qui :
> > - demare apache
> > - enregistre l'ip dans un fisier
> > - systematiquement le daemon cree lit l'ip enregistre dans le fisier et
l'ip du pppo et si il est diferent redemare apache.
> > - maintenant comme je ne suis pas un programeur du tout je vous demande
d'e maider a resolver ce probleme.
> >
> > mersi a tous e bonne continuation.
> > je suis ouvert a tout proposition de votre part.
> > by
>
> Voil� comment j'ai configur� apache, dans la m�me situation que toi avec
des virtual hosts :
>
> Dans le fichier httpd.conf :
>
> ServerName *
>
> puis, pour les virtuals hosts:
>
> NameVirtualhost *
>
> <VirtualHost *>
> ServerName www.monsite.net
> DocumentRoot /chemin/des/html
> </VirtualHost>
>
> <VirtualHost *>
> ServerName moi.monsite.net
> DocumentRoot /autre/chemin/des/html
> </VirtualHost>
>
> J'ai post� cette astuce sur lea-linux.org
>
> En fait, je ne pr�cise pas d'ip mais une * � la place.
> Mon serveur apache tourne 24/24 sans que le changement d'ip ne pose pb.
>
> J'ai pas pu poster sur la liste confirme, peux-tu le faire?
> Olivier
>

___________________________________________________________
Do You Yahoo!? -- Une adresse @yahoo.fr gratuite et en fran�ais !
Yahoo! Mail : http://fr.mail.yahoo.com

Vous souhaitez acquerir votre Pack ou des Services MandrakeSoft?
Rendez-vous sur "http://www.mandrakestore.com";

Répondre à